Tullamore town centre street parking and council carparks currently allow for 15 mins free parking, in a legal parking space, without displaying a valid parking ticket.
This free period has been extended to one hour until Wednesday, December 31. You can park for up to one hour without purchasing a parking ticket. The one-hour free parking, in a legal parking space, will apply to all parking zones below. Please note that, if continuing to park, a parking ticket must be purchased and displayed after the hour free parking period has expired as per the zoned rates below:
Free parking all day every Sunday
Free parking all day every day at Daingean Rd. Carpark (5 mins walk to town centre)
First 3 hours free parking at O’Neill’s Place Carpark until 31st December 2025 (entrance - beside of Spollen’s Pub)
Cashless Parking – Pay by app. Download the Payzone app on Android or iOS

Parking Zones
Yellow – 2-hour max stay; €1 per hour with second hour free (0.50c per 30mins) Streets - Bridge Lane, Columcille Street, Harbour Street, High Street (North), Patrick Street
Green - 2 hour max stay; €1 per hour (0.50c per 30mins); Carparks - Kilbride Park, Lloyd Town Park, Market Square West, Tara Street; Streets - Benburb Street, Chapel Street, Church Street, Cormac Street, Deane Place, High St (South West), Kilbride Park, Kilbride Street, Market Place, O’Carroll Street, O’Moore Street, Offaly Street, St. Brigid’s Place (North & South), St. Kyran’s Street, Tanyard, Waterlane
White – 1 hour max stay; €1 per hour (0.50c per 30mins); Carparks - Kilbride Street South, O’Connor Square
Blue - All day or part thereof €2.50; Carparks - Kilbride Street North, Market Square East, O’Neill’s Place, Tanyard; Streets - Convent Road, Store Street, St. Brigid’s Place East and West.
